Pricing ambiguity is a product issue, not a footnote
When several equivalents and billing periods appear together, a buyer can easily compare numbers that do not describe the same commitment. Kupid may still offer good value, but the checkout must settle which tab is active, what charges immediately and whether a lifetime option has different allowances. Bond Circuit refuses to choose one visible number and strip away that context.
The feature breadth deserves a scenario test
Kupid should be trialed with one realistic journey: configure a character, establish a few preferences, continue the conversation later, then request voice or media that depends on those choices. That exposes whether the stack is integrated and whether the plan meter supports normal use, rather than merely confirming that buttons exist.
Price and commitment signal
The page simultaneously exposed weekly equivalents, struck-through amounts, yearly/lifetime tabs, and a $299/year billing statement. The selected plan/toggle relationship needs a direct UI test.
We do not borrow prices from other review sites, and we do not infer a plan from an annual equivalent or a partially loaded checkout.

What remains unknown
No hands-on account test means conversation quality, real memory retention, regeneration quality, latency and long-term reliability remain unknown. That is particularly important when a brand promises a relationship that "grows" over time.
We also did not settle these fields from the public surface: mobile app claim.
